Healthcare recruitment company says Gardaí probing ‘cyber security incident’

Healthdaq, a healthcare recruitment company with offices in Belfast and Dublin, has reported that the Gardaí are investigating a cyber security incident affecting its operations. The company, which specializes in connecting healthcare professionals with job opportunities, has not disclosed specific details regarding the nature of the incident or the extent of any potential data breach.

The investigation by the Gardaí is ongoing, and Healthdaq has stated that it is cooperating fully with the authorities. The company aims to ensure the security of its systems and the protection of any sensitive information that may have been compromised. Healthdaq has also indicated that it is taking necessary precautions to mitigate any risks associated with the incident.

As the investigation unfolds, Healthdaq has advised its clients and candidates to remain vigilant regarding any suspicious activity related to their personal information. The company is committed to maintaining transparency throughout the process and will provide updates as more information becomes available.

This incident highlights the growing concern around cyber security in the healthcare sector, a field that increasingly relies on digital platforms for recruitment and management. The implications of such breaches can be significant, affecting not only the companies involved but also the professionals and patients who rely on their services.

The outcome of the Gardaí’s investigation may lead to further discussions on the importance of cyber security measures within the healthcare recruitment industry in Northern Ireland/The North and beyond.
